CAPLESS PEDICLE SCREW SYSTEM
The Capless Pedicle Screw System is indicated for the treatment of severe spondylolisthesis (Grade 3and 4) of the L5-S1 vertebra in skeletally mature patients receiving fusion by autogenous bone graft having implants attached to the lumbar and sacral spine (L3 to sacrum) with removal of the implants after the attainment of a solid fusion.
The Capless Pedicle Screw System is intended to provide immobilization and stabilization of spinal segments in skeletally mature patients as an adjunct to fusion in the treatment of the following acute and chronic instabilities or deformities of the thoracic. lumbar and sacral spine: degenerative spondylolisthesis with objective evidence of neurological impairment, fracture, dislocation, scoliosis, kyphosis, spinal tumor, and failed previous fusion (pseudarthrosis).
Capless rods are 5.5 mm diameter solid cylinders with spherically rounded ends. provided in 40 mm, 60 mm, 100 mm, 120 mm, 140 mm, 160 mm, 160 mm, 200 mm, and 300 mm lengths.
Each Capless pedicle screw assembly consists of a pedicle screw, yoke, and screw cap. Self-tapping pedicle screw assemblies are provided in diameters of 5.5 mm, 6.5 mm. and 7.5 mm. The 5.5 mm diameter screw assemblics are provided in lengths of 30 mm, 35 mm, 40 mm, 45 mm, 50 mm, and 55 mm. The 6.5 mm diameter screw assemblies arc provided in lengths of 40 mm, 45 mm, 50 mm, and 55 mm. The 7.5 mm diameter screw assemblies are provided in lengths of 30 mm, 35 mm, 40 mm, 45 mm, 50 mm, and 55 ınm.
The Capless cross bar assembly is an optional component and can be used for additional stabilization. Cross bar assemblies are available in lengths from 25 mm to 81 mm.
The rods, pedicle screws and transverse links of the Capless Pedicle Screw System are made of titanium alloy conforming to ASTM F136.
